One personality test was created by “Katharine Briggs and her daughter Isabel Briggs Myers [they] found Jung's types and functions so revealing of people's personalities that they decided to develop a paper-and-pencil test. It came to be called the Myers-Briggs Type Indicator, and is one of the most popular, and most studied, tests around” (Boeree). One example of the use of a personality test to achieve higher performance is at Virginia Tech Rescue Squad. Paul N, a paramedic, of VT Rescue has recently had the members take a personality test to try and obtain a better understanding of the different types of members in the organization. His purpose for using the personality test was to “discover trends, and to see if there is a dominant personality.” One of the things he wanted was to have the members “find out more about themselves, and to be more conscientious of people they work with.” He believes that the “corporate culture can use the tests to find similar personalities, which will allow for superior effectiveness.” As Newman stated, businesses can use personality tests to enhance and discover the abilities of members and future members.
